Chat with us, powered by LiveChat The main objective of this assignment is to familiarize you with object-oriented design and programming. - Writeden

The main objective of this assignment is to familiarize you with object-oriented design and programming. Object-oriented programming helps to solve complex problems by coming up with a number of domain classes and associations. However, identifying meaningful classes and interactions requires a fair amount of design experience. Such experience cannot be gained by classroom-based teaching alone but must be gained through project experience. This assignment is designed to introduce different concepts such as inheritance, method overriding, and polymorphism.

 

The detailed requirements and information you may need are all in the attachment.